Can White Sox Leverage Home Advantage Against Angels at Rate Field?

As the White Sox prepare to host the Angels at Rate Field, fans are eagerly anticipating what promises to be an engaging matchup. With both teams looking to make their mark early in the season, this game is set to be a critical juncture for the home team, especially considering their performance last season.

Analyzing Last Season's Performance


The White Sox's previous season was marked by challenges and areas for improvement. With a batting average of .221 and an on-base percentage (OBP) of 27 percent, it's clear that enhancing offensive output will be crucial for the team. The slugging percentage stood at 34 percent, indicating a need for more power-hitting capabilities from the lineup. On the pitching side, an earned run average (ERA) of 4.671 and a walks plus hits per inning pitched (WHIP) of 1.4366 highlight areas where tightening up control and reducing opponents' opportunities could benefit the team significantly.


Looking Ahead: Strategies and Expectations


For this upcoming game against the Angels, focusing on improving hitting statistics will be key for the White Sox. Capitalizing on runs batted in (RBI) opportunities and increasing home runs could turn tight games in their favor. Additionally, with a fielding percentage of 98 percent from last season showing solid defensive capabilities, maintaining this standard will be essential in supporting their pitchers.

On defense, minimizing errors which stood at 90 last season will help keep runners off base paths and limit scoring opportunities for the Angels. Pitchers will need to focus on lowering their ERA by striking out more batters while walking fewer - leveraging their strikeout-to-walk ratio which was previously at 2.12.


The venue itself may play into strategies as well; playing at Rate Field offers familiarity with field dimensions and crowd support that can energize home performances.
